Hot on the heels of the Open Championship, the next Major to be contested is The Presidents Putter, a competition between the Perth Rotary Clubs. This gives the winners bragging rights for the next year.
So… in the face of stiff competition the Rotary Club of Perth regained the President's putter after a number of lean years.
The triumphant team won by an average Stableford score of 15.5 to 14.65. We extend a big thank you to Perth Kinnoull Club for organising the event and the 10 Perth players who excelled on the night.
Graham Duncan was the best player from our side and he was almost overcome by the prize of 2 balls. This allowed him to retain his amateur status.
